The Great Seal of Queen Victoria, c1895
EDITORS COMMENTS
is a captivating print that encapsulates the grandeur and power of Queen Victoria's reign. Taken from Cassells Illustrated History of England, this engraving showcases the monarch in all her regal glory. In the image, Queen Victoria sits atop a magnificent horse, exuding confidence and authority. Her elegant riding attire reflects her status as the sovereign ruler of Great Britain and Ireland. Surrounded by courtiers and an attentive audience, she commands attention with every prancing step of her mount. The Great Seal held by Queen Victoria symbolizes her authority over the country. It serves as a reminder of her role as both a leader and protector to her people. The seal itself is intricately designed, representing centuries-old traditions that have been passed down through generations. This 19th-century publication captures a pivotal moment in British history when Queen Victoria reigned over an empire on which "the sun never set". As one gazes upon this monochrome masterpiece, it transports us back to an era where royalty was revered and respected. Queen Victoria's legacy continues to be celebrated even today. Her reign marked significant advancements in industry, culture, and politics for Britain. This print serves as a testament to her enduring influence on not only the nation but also on future generations who continue to admire and study her remarkable life.
